Brazilian manufacturer Embraer is the world’s third-largest producer of civil aircraft. In other words, it is the best of the rest when it comes to manufacturers from outside the industry-dominating Airbus-Boeing duopoly. To date, it has delivered more than 8,000 aircraft with more than half a century of manufacturing history. But where exactly does it build them?
